First off, you gotta get yourself some peanuts. Not just any peanuts, mind you, but the good ones. The ones that look plump and smell… well, like peanuts, I guess. You gotta roast ’em, see? Like you’re warmin’ ’em up by the fire, but in your oven. That’s what them city folks call “baking”. Makes ’em all toasty and gets the oil outta them, so they turn all smooth and creamy when you grind ’em up. I hear some folks put ’em in at 350 degrees, but my oven? It’s got “low”, “medium” and “high”, so I just put it somewhere in the middle. Gotta watch it, though, don’t want ’em burnin’. Burnt peanuts ain’t no good to nobody.

Now, the honey part, that’s where the magic happens. You don’t want just any old honey, neither. You want the good stuff, the thick and golden kind. The kind that sticks to your spoon and tastes like sunshine. Mix it in with them roasted peanuts, not too much, not too little. You gotta get it just right, you know? Like when you’re makin’ biscuits, gotta have that feel for it. Some folks like it sweet, some like it not so sweet. It’s all up to you.
- Get good peanuts, them plump ones
- Roast them peanuts till they’re warm and toasty, don’t burn ‘em!
- Use good honey, thick and gold
- Mix it all together, not too much, not too little
I’ve heard tell of folks adding other stuff too. A pinch of salt, maybe. Or a little bit of oil, if it’s too thick. Some folks even put in extra sugar, but I reckon the honey’s sweet enough on its own. You can play around with it, see what you like.
